Update.

Alaska sent me a letter and a check today to close out my claim. They repaid me $800 after my flight for the items I purchased and today the closed it out with an additional $1,800 check.

The total for our claimed items was $3,300 and they repayment was $2,600. Not too bad.

I learned a few things about the process:

  1. They don’t cover any jewelry. That was $550 of the claim right off the top that wasn’t covered.

  2. Any item that’s valued over $100 needs a receipt. If you don’t have a receipt then the item is valued at $100 and that’s what you’re payed.

That basically accounted for the missing money from the claim total. I wish we would have known that jewelry wasn’t covered because I would have substituted “jacket” for “necklace” lol.
